Extracts of today's Special Sunday Service
Text: Acts 1:4-8
Ministering: Pastor E. A. Adeboye

After the resurrection, what next? Ecclesiastes 7:8. Better is the end of a thing than the beginning thereof. Jesus told the disciples that He would send someone who will help them fulfill their destiny. John 16:7. According to Jesus, the Holy Spirit would give the disciples power.

Power is the ability to do work and do it efficiently and a times extraordinarily. 
There are different categories of power.
1. Political Power. Ecclesiastes 8:4
2. Financial power. Proverbs 10:15, Ecclesiastes 7:12
3. Spiritual power. 2 Kings 4:8-17.
4. Counterfeit Power. Acts 8:9-24
Power supersedes power. Exodus 7:8-12




Why do you need to have the power of the Holy Spirit?
1. To fulfill destiny. Luke 5:1-11, Acts 2:1-41.
Paul's destiny was to preach the Gospel. Galatians 1:15-16, Acts 9:10-20. Also, the greater the power, the easier it is to reach your goal.

For example, the power of God was manifested in great dimensions in the life of Peter. Acts 3:1-11, Acts 4:4. 1st sermon, he won 3000 souls. 2nd sermon, the power was greater; he won 5000 souls. His destiny was fulfilled at an amazing pace. Acts 5:1-16
Don't pay attention to those who mock you when you pray in the Holy Spirit. The Bible says you speak mysteries to God when you pray in the Holy Spirit. The end will justify the means so use it. If you don't use the power, you will lose it! Pray more in the Holy Spirit. Romans 8:26. Use the Power so it can multiply.

For those who haven't received the power of the Holy Spirit; Acts 2:37-39
1. Repent
2. Be baptized (by immersion)
3. Begin to use the power; join the workforce
And watch the Almighty God begin to move you closer to destiny.
